
[Chris Johnston] With the Canucks believed to be among those pursuing Jake Guentzel, word is they’ve had discussions about potentially flipping Elias Lindholm to the Bruins as part of the machinations to make it happen.
Nothing concrete in place at this time. Still lots of moving parts.
